Book readers searching for a large screen eReader sure to be interested in a new 10.3 inch Android based eReader which has been launched via the Kickstarter crowdfunding website this week with the aim of raising CAD$300,000 over the next 60 days. Check out the demonstration video below to learn more about the design, features and pledges available via Kickstarter.
It’s creator Michael Kozlowski explains more about the Frontlight and Comfortlight technology incorporated into the Android Good eReader. “The Good e-Reader 10.3 Android e-reader! You can take notes and draw pictures with the built in handwriting app and accompanied stylus. This is the first 10.3 inch E-Ink reader in the world that has a front-lit display and a Comfort light system. What is Comfort Light? The front light can be set to automatically adjust the color of the light based on the time of day, from a cool blue tone during daylight hours to a warm orange hue at night. This process can be set to automatic or can be manually adjusted. The lightning system has 15 white LED’s and 14 warm LED’s.”
